Y?JNAVALKYA> Indian astronomer, perhaps of the second millennium b.c. Y?jnavalkya is one of the foremost figures in the earliest period of Indian astronomy. There is no unanimity about his time, which has been estimated in an indirect manner. His time was considered to have been around 800 b.c., based on the dating of the Shatapatha Br?hma?a—a voluminous prose text from his school, which serves as a commentary on Vedic ritual—by nineteenth-century philologists. These philological theories have been called into question by new archaeological data, and his true period may be the second millennium b.c.
Y?jnavalkya's parents were Brahmaratha and Sunand?. He studied first in the hermitage of Vaishamp?yana and later with B?shkala and Udd?laka. He is credited with the authorship of the Shukla (White) Yajurveda. He is also credited with the school that put together the Shatapatha Br?hma?a. Many dialogues of Y?jnavalkya with his disciples and with rival sages are preserved in the Vedic literature. Legends connect him to the sun; this may be a slanted reference to his discovery of two important facts about the motions of the sun.
In the Shatapatha Br?hma?a, Y?jnavalkya advances two important theories: first, that a cycle of ninety-five years is required to reconcile the lunar and the solar years (indicating that the length of the year was known to a great degree of accuracy); second, that the circuit of the sun is asymmetric in its four quarters. The proportion for the two halves of the year described by him is 176:189. It is interesting that this proportion is also used in describing the asymmetry of the two halves in the Angkor Wat temple in Cambodia (c. 1150). Y?jnavalkya's astronomy is very important in the history of ideas because it pushes the recognition of the ninety-five-year lunisolar cycle and the asymmetry of the year to a much earlier time than has been supposed.
Y?jnavalkya's astronomy belongs to a period in which astronomical knowledge was part of ritual. Complicated geometrical altars were built to represent the year, with facts about the year expressed in terms of number or area within the altar design. Y?jnavalkya is a major figure in early Vedic thought, renowned for his stress on the correspondence between the outer world and the inner world. Many of his dialogues form a part of the narrative of the Brihad-?ranyaka-Upanishad, in which he mentions a preliminary version of the Pur??ic system of cosmology.
